British Microlight Aircraft Association
The BMAA looks after the interests of microlight owners in the UK. It has powers to control training and airworthiness, and its aims are to further the sport of microlight aviation, while keeping flying costs down to a minimum.

Royal Air Force Museum
Britain's National Museum of Aviation, opened in 1972, celebrates the story of aviation from before the Wright Brothers to the present, with an extensive collection of aircraft and associated exhibits. There are some interactive online exhibits, in QuickTime format, designed to create the immersive illusion of standing in a particular spot within a photographed environment.
